How online changes everything

Some of the biggest financial transactions involving games companies in recent years have been by traditional media buying studios in the online space. From Vivendi merging with Activision to Disney’s acquisition of Club Penguin, big media moving into games have tended to stick with what they know – massmarket entertainment.
